Four years ago I was told I had chronic asthma. For an entire year after that diagnosis, I fought it. Physically — emotionally. I refused to believe it. Every sign was there, every test pointed to the same conclusion, and still I told myself they were wrong. I did not want to be someone who needed daily medication for the rest of my life. ... Growing up in New England, I was always surrounded by antiques, though I didn’t begin selling them until 2009 when I opened my Etsy shop. At the time, I was doing a lot of assemblage art and had a surplus of supplies. I thought other people might be able to use this kind of material too, and they did! Gradually, I moved away from...
